It sure stinks that Agalloch mastermind John Haughm turned out to be an anti-Semitic edgelord, doesn’t it? Despite the rest of his former bandmembers’ denunciation of Haughm’s language and claims that “he is NOT Agalloch,” I’ve found it incredibly difficult to listen to the band’s music lately (I haven’t at all) despite its importance to me.

Enter Falls of Rauros, a band we’ve covered before on this site, although admittedly not nearly enough. The Portland, ME black metallers will release a new album in July, and Decibel has blessed us with a single from the album that I’ve been playing over and over ever since it came out a couple weeks back. In short, “New Inertia” provides great hope that Patterns in Mythology will take the mantle from Agalloch (see what I did there?) of dynamic, progressive, experimental black metal and bring it to new places, substantiating Decibel scribe Vince Bellino’s claim that’ll end up being one of the best albums of 2019.
